Thanks Ashley. Too bad I…
Thanks Ashley. Too bad I think. The inner bores have worn oval. I'll have a proposer measure up shortly. Were the bores reamed for the larger spindles?

The worst is the inner bore…
The worst is the inner bore of the LH exhaust spindle. That has 0.018" up and down

How bad is bad, it might be possible to get some oversize spindles. I had some made some years ago in +0.005 and 0.008'' who we sold them too might still have them.
